要在Python中安装Turtle库,你需要确保你的Python环境已经配置好,安装Turtle库的步骤主要包括:检查Python版本、使用pip进行安装、验证安装成功。其中,使用pip进行安装是最关键的一步,因为pip是Python官方推荐的包管理工具,它可以自动解决包的依赖关系,确保安装的库能够正常运行。接下来我们详细讲解这些步骤。
一、检查Python版本
在安装Turtle库之前,首先要确保你已经安装了Python,并且Python的版本不低于3.0。因为Turtle库在Python 3及以上版本中已经包含在标准库中,所以不需要额外安装。但如果你使用的是Python 2.x版本,那么可能需要升级到Python 3。
1. 检查Python版本
打开命令行终端(Windows用户可以使用命令提示符,Mac和Linux用户可以使用终端),输入以下命令来检查Python版本:
python --version
或者,如果系统中同时安装了Python 2和Python 3,可以使用:
python3 --version
确保输出的版本号是3.x.x,这表明你当前使用的是Python 3。
二、使用pip进行安装
虽然Turtle库已经包含在Python 3的标准库中,但如果你想使用其他扩展功能或确保库的完整性,可以通过pip进行重新安装。
1. 安装pip
如果你的系统中还没有安装pip,你可以通过以下命令来安装它:
对于Windows用户:
python -m ensurepip --upgrade
对于Mac和Linux用户:
python3 -m ensurepip --upgrade
2. 使用pip安装Turtle库
在命令行中输入以下命令来安装Turtle库:
pip install PythonTurtle
或者,如果你使用的是Python 3:
pip3 install PythonTurtle
这将安装一个名为PythonTurtle的扩展包,它是Turtle库的一个图形化界面版本,适合初学者使用。
三、验证安装成功
为了确保Turtle库已经正确安装,你可以通过在Python环境中导入该库来进行验证。
1. 导入Turtle库
在命令行中输入python
或python3
进入Python解释器,然后输入以下命令:
import turtle
如果没有错误信息出现,说明Turtle库已经成功安装并可以使用。
2. 运行一个简单的Turtle程序
为了进一步验证,你可以运行一个简单的Turtle程序。输入以下代码来绘制一个简单的图形:
import turtle
创建一个Turtle对象
t = turtle.Turtle()
绘制一个四边形
for _ in range(4):
t.forward(100) # 向前移动100单位
t.right(90) # 右转90度
结束Turtle绘图
turtle.done()
如果你看到一个窗口弹出并绘制了一个四边形,说明Turtle库已经可以正常工作。
四、配置和使用Turtle库
在成功安装和验证Turtle库后,你可以根据需要进行配置和使用。Turtle库提供了丰富的绘图功能,可以帮助你在学习编程的过程中更好地理解图形和动画的概念。
1. Turtle库的基本使用
Turtle库提供了简单易用的API,可以帮助你快速创建复杂的图形和动画。以下是一些基本命令的介绍:
turtle.forward(distance)
: 向前移动指定的距离。turtle.backward(distance)
: 向后移动指定的距离。turtle.right(angle)
: 顺时针旋转指定的角度。turtle.left(angle)
: 逆时针旋转指定的角度。turtle.penup()
: 提起画笔,移动时不会绘制。turtle.pendown()
: 放下画笔,移动时会绘制。turtle.goto(x, y)
: 移动到指定的坐标位置。turtle.circle(radius)
: 绘制一个指定半径的圆。
2. 自定义Turtle的外观
你可以通过设置Turtle的颜色、形状和速度来自定义它的外观:
turtle.color("blue") # 设置画笔颜色为蓝色
turtle.shape("turtle") # 设置Turtle的形状为乌龟
turtle.speed(2) # 设置绘图速度
Turtle库为初学者提供了一个有趣的学习平台,通过动手绘制图形,可以更好地理解编程中的循环、条件判断等基本概念。
五、解决常见问题
在安装和使用Turtle库的过程中,可能会遇到一些常见问题。以下是一些解决方案:
1. 安装失败或找不到Turtle库
如果在安装过程中遇到问题,可以检查以下几点:
- 确保你的Python版本是3.x。
- 确保pip已经安装并且是最新版本。
- 检查网络连接是否正常,因为pip需要通过网络下载库。
2. Turtle程序无法运行
如果运行Turtle程序时出现错误,可以检查以下几点:
- 确保已经正确导入Turtle库。
- 检查代码是否存在语法错误。
- 确保没有其他程序占用了Turtle的绘图窗口。
通过以上步骤和解决方案,你应该能够成功安装和使用Turtle库,从而开始你的Python编程之旅。Turtle库是一个学习编程的绝佳工具,希望你在使用过程中能够享受乐趣并有所收获。
相关问答FAQs:
如何在Python中检查turtle模块是否已经安装?
可以通过在Python命令行或脚本中尝试导入turtle模块来确认它是否已经安装。只需输入import turtle
,如果没有错误提示,说明模块已经成功安装。如果出现错误消息,则需要进行安装。
安装turtle模块需要哪些Python版本?
turtle模块是Python的标准库之一,通常在Python的所有版本中都已经包含。因此,用户只需确保安装的是Python 3.x版本,便可以直接使用turtle模块,无需单独安装。
在Windows和Mac上安装turtle有何不同?
在Windows和Mac上,turtle模块的使用方式基本相同,因为它是Python标准库的一部分。用户只需确保Python环境已正确安装。在Windows中,可以通过Python的安装程序进行安装,而在Mac上,用户可以通过Homebrew或直接从官网下载安装包进行设置。无论哪个系统,完成安装后都可以直接使用turtle模块。
在使用turtle时,如何解决常见的错误?
在使用turtle模块时,可能会遇到一些常见错误。例如,如果图形窗口无法显示,可以检查是否在合适的环境中运行代码(如IDLE或Jupyter Notebook)。此外,确保在使用turtle绘图时调用turtle.done()
,以便正确结束绘图并显示图形。如遇其他问题,可以参考Python的官方文档或社区论坛寻求帮助。